This position is for the United States Army Reserves or Active Duty.

As a Human Resources Specialist , you’ll play a crucial role in assisting your fellow Soldiers to progress in their Army careers, providing promotion and future training information.

You’ll ensure the necessary support is also provided to commanders across all branches. You’ll be trained in document preparation, drafting requests, and overseeing official documentation, such as ID cards and tags.

You’ll also learn computer programs that keep personnel data up to date.
